Q: Is 20,224,280 a Prime Number?
A: No, 20,224,280 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 20224280 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 40 505,607 1,011,214 2,022,428 2,528,035 4,044,856 5,056,070 10,112,140 and 20,224,280, with no remainder.
Since 20,224,280 cannot be divided by just 1 and 20,224,280, it is not a prime number.
